News

Le lundi est le jour de l'inspiration chez Smashing Magazine, et ils rassemblent des centaines d'exemples et d'expériences sur des approches innovantes.
Cette semaine, lundi est consacré aux représentations innovantes de données, avec des supports comme des drapeaux, des cartes avec des noms de domaines, ou encore le coût des nouvelles technologies depuis 50 ans.

Beaucoup de bonnes idées à piocher si vous recherchez comment représenter certaines informations.

- Monday Inspiration: Data Visualization and Infographics
- Monday Inspiration: Innovative Designs and Devices
- Monday Inspiration: Paper Strips Menus
- Monday Inspiration: Creative Workplaces
- Monday Inspiration: Typography In Motion
le 14/01/2008 à 20:09
4 tests pour PHP_SELF
PHP_SELF (ou $_SERVER['PHP_SELF']) est sujet à des injections XSS tout comme n'importe quelle variable $_GET ou $_POST. En fait, le serveur Web prend les informations provenant de l'utilisateur pour construire cette variable, et même s'il y a quelques vérifications de plus que pour une variable $_GET (il faut bien que l'URI soit résolue pour être exécutée), il est possible de glisser des injections HTML dans PHP_SELF.

Gareth Heyes publie 4 tests à appliquer à une page pour voir si elle est vulnérable à une attaque XSS via PHP_SELF.

- EXPLOITING PHP SELF
- XSS Woes
La Commission européenne a annoncé ce lundi l'ouverture de deux nouvelles enquêtes relatives à la conduite de Microsoft sur le marché des logiciels. Comme dans les précédentes affaires ayant opposé l'éditeur de Redmond à Bruxelles, il est question d'abus de position dominante. Ici, l'ouverture de ces enquêtes est motivée par le dépôt de deux plaintes. La première émane d'Opera Software tandis que la seconde vient du groupe ECIS (European Committee for Interoperable Systems - Comité européen pour l'interopabilité des systèmes), qui s'oppose de longue date à la politique de Microsoft en matière de systèmes d'exploitation et de logiciels.

"L'ouverture de ces procédures ne signifie pas que la Commission dispose de preuves attestant une infraction. Elle signifie seulement que la Commission enquêtera sur ces dossiers en priorité", précise Bruxelles dans un communiqué.

Opera explique que Microsoft abuse de sa position dominante sur le marché des logiciels pour imposer son navigateur Web Internet Explorer et reproche à la société de Redmond d'avoir lié Internet Explorer à Windows afin d'asseoir son monopole sur le marché des navigateurs Web. Le groupe ECIS estime quant à lui que Microsoft ne fournit pas les informations nécessaires à la bonne interopérabilité de logiciels concurrents avec sa gamme de produits, allant de Windows à Office et Outlook.

En octobre dernier, Microsoft avait fini par se plier aux conditions édictées par la Commission européenne suite à un premier verdict remontant à 2004, à l'occasion duquel il avait été condamné à verser 497 millions d'euros d'amende. Aujourd'hui, les éditeurs tiers qui le souhaitent peuvent pour 10.000 euros accéder à une documentation technique leur permettant de garantir l'interopérabilité de leurs logiciels avec les produits serveurs de Microsoft.
Microsoft continue de peaufiner le tant attendu Service Pack 1 pour Windows Vista. Après avoir mis le SP1 RC (Release Candidate) a disposition de tous, la firme de Redmond en remet une couche aujourd'hui en publiant une mise à jour "importante" de ce même pack.

Le "Windows Vista Service Pack 1 Release Candidate Refresh" (ouf !), introduit selon Microsoft de nombreux changements qui doivent "corriger un certain nombre de bugs, améliorer les performances et la compatibilité du système". Les utilisateurs ayant déjà installé le SP1 RC pour Windows Vista devront le désinstaller avant de pouvoir basculer vers cette nouvelle mouture. Plusieurs redémarrages de la machine sont également à prévoir et il faudra environ 1 heure pour procéder à l'installation.

Le SP1 RC Refresh de Windows Vista doit fonctionner jusqu'au 30 juin 2008. Si tout va bien Microsoft devrait publier la version finale de ce SP1 pour Vista d'ici la fin du mois de mars. Microsoft ne conseille pas d'installer ce SP1 RC Refresh sur les ordinateurs utilisés pour des tâches importantes.

Pour le moment, Windows Vista SP1 RC Refresh n'est disponible qu'en anglais comme on peut le voir sur cette page. Avis aux apprentis testeurs !
Succès.fr ? Près de quatre ans après l'assouplissement de leur attribution aux entreprise et 18 mois après leur ouverture aux particuliers, les noms de domaine en ".fr" ont officiellement passé le cap du million en fin de semaine dernière.

"Il y a actuellement 1019092 domaines .fr et .re délégués par l'AFNIC et répartis comme suit : 1017336 noms de domaine enregistrés sous .fr ; 1756 noms de domaine enregistrés sous .re.", pouvait on lire ce lundi sur le site de l'AFNIC, Association Française pour le Nommage Internet en Coopération, responsable de la gestion de l'extension. Ce serait plus précisemment une certaine Lucile Reynard, heureuse titulaire du domaine "blogartdeco.fr", qui aurait franchi ce cap symbolique.

"L'accès des particuliers au .fr n'est pas le seul facteur expliquant la dynamique très forte que connaît le .fr. Il faut citer des tarifs très compétitifs et des procédures automatisées permettant un enregistrement et une activation rapides des noms de domaine. Sans oublier la relation privilégiée qu'ont les internautes français avec le .fr, associant celui-ci à la francophonie, à l'appartenance à la communauté française de l'internet et à la proximité. Le .fr reste également plus que jamais l'extension la plus intuitive pour trouver le site internet d'une entreprise française." commente l'Afnic dans un communiqué.

En moins de quatre ans, les domaines nationaux français auront donc plus que quintupler. Cette force croissance ne masque toutefois pas le retard pris par les .fr qui restent très loin derrières des extensions génériques comme le .com (71 millions), ou nationales comme l'extension allemande .de (11 millions) ou même le .nl, extension néerlandaise, qui comptabilise 2,6 millions de dépôts selon DomainesInfo.fr malgré une population quatre fois inférieure à celle de la France.
Le cybermarchand Amazon est bien décidé à ne pas se laisser faire. Condamné en première instance pour proposer des frais de ports gratuits sur les ventes de livres, Amazon a annoncé qu'il allait faire appel de la décision de justice prononcée à son encontre. En attendant le verdict, le célèbre site de ventes organise sa riposte en mobilisant ses clients. Dans un email signé par Jeff Besos, son PDG (voir ci-dessous), Amazon invite ainsi ses clients à signer une pétition afin que les frais de port gratuits sur livre soient maintenus et que la justice prenne en compte certains de ses arguments. Amazon accuse également le syndicat de libraires, qui l'a assigné, de vouloir éliminer la concurrence d'Amazon.

"Aussi incroyable que cela paraisse, la livraison gratuite chez Amazon.fr est menacée. Amazon.fr est en effet condamnée au paiement d'une amende de 1 000 euros par jour parce qu'elle propose la livraison gratuite de livres à ses clients. Cette amende est le résultat préliminaire d'une action en justice intentée par un syndicat de libraires. Nous avons choisi de faire appel de cette décision et de payer l'amende afin de pouvoir continuer à offrir la livraison à nos clients.

Les poursuites de ce syndicat ne sont ni plus ni moins qu'une tentative cynique d'éliminer la concurrence d'Amazon.fr. L'argumentation juridique du syndicat s'appuie sur la loi Lang, qui limite les réductions de prix sur les livres proposées par les détaillants. L'ironie de cette tactique est que la loi Lang a pour but de préserver la diversité de la création culturelle et de donner aux libraires les moyens de proposer une large sélection de livres, et pas seulement les best-sellers.

Or Amazon.fr, qui pratique déjà la remise maximale sur les livres autorisée par la loi Lang, met à votre disposition la plus vaste offre de livres en français disponibles dans le monde, qu'ils soient neufs ou d'occasion, et quels que soient la renommée de leurs auteurs et le prestige de leurs éditeurs. Aussi, la tentative injustifiée du syndicat de supprimer la livraison gratuite n'aurait qu'une seule conséquence : vous devrez payer plus cher pour acheter vos livres. Et cela constituerait un cas unique : la France serait ainsi le seul pays au monde où la livraison gratuite pratiquée par Amazon serait déclarée illégale.

Vous pouvez faire entendre votre voix dans ce combat pour la livraison gratuite. Nous avons créé une pétition en ligne que nous vous invitons à signer : Pétition en ligne"

Reste maintenant à voir si cette pétition aura une quelconque incidence et quel sera le verdict de la Cour d'appel...
Le président d'Opera s'est exprimé dernièrement sur les avancés liées au développement de la version 9.5 du célèbre navigateur du même nom. Pour rappel, cette firme norvégienne dispose désormais du navigateur Web ayant le plus d'années de développement à son actif depuis la disparition annoncée de Netscape Navigator et contrôle à présent 2% du marché américain.

D'après les dires de son responsable, Opera 9.5 devrait offrir des performances accrues, notamment au niveau des applications Web et du Javascript. Le représentant de la firme n'hésite d'ailleurs pas à affirmer qu'Opera 9.5 sera, dans certains cas, deux fois plus rapide que son prédécesseur (Opera 9.1) ou 10 fois plus rapide qu'Internet Explorer de Microsoft. Opera 9.5 proposera aussi un cache dédié à la recherche, l'utilisateur pourra ainsi retrouver une adresse Web ou un fichier téléchargé, simplement en utilisant un mot clé.

Une première version beta d'Opera 9.5 est déjà disponible, d'autres versions seront proposés d'ici les deux prochains mois et la version finale devrait être disponible d'ici l'été prochain. Parallèlement à cela, la firme se félicite de la popularité remportée par ses navigateurs Web pour téléphones mobiles : Opera Mini et Opera Mobile. Des navigateurs qui pourraient bien être portés sur l'iPhone d'Apple prochainement... A l'heure actuelle, Opera Mini est déjà utilisé par 30 millions de personnes et Opera enregistre 100 000 nouveaux téléchargements chaque jour pour ce navigateur.
le 13/01/2008 à 21:26
Compiler MySQL 5.0.51 sur Ubuntu 7.10
Ronald Bradford publie une liste de solutions pour ceux qui compilent MySQL sur Ubuntu 7.10, avec les explications aux écueils les plus courants.

"Cela faisait longtemps que je n'avais pas compilé [MySQL] depuis les sources, et, pour la situation, la première fois que je le faisais sur Ubuntu 7.10 (une installation propre). Voici certains problèmes et les solutions associées, pour éviter à tout le monde de bloquer sur la même chose."

- Compiling MySQL 5.0.51 under Ubuntu 7.10
- Blogue Ronald Bradford
le 13/01/2008 à 21:24
Ce que PHP fait de bien
Ian Bicking rappelle que PHP est fait pour le Web, et non pas le contraire : les modules PHP n'ont pas été des interfaces additionnelles à des langages établis, comme Python ou Ruby, mais bien des développements spécifiques, et totalement en phase avec le contexte d'exécution : PHP perd de la mémoire? Qui s'en soucie, le processus sera mort à la fin de la page.

L'autre grande force de PHP que rappelle Ian est la philosophie 'share nothing', où instances de PHP ne se marchent pas sur les pieds les unes des autres. Et les applications "qui fonctionnent fonctionnent toujours même après une modification de PHP. (même celles qui marchent à moitié continuent de marcher à moitié."

- What PHP Deployment Gets Right
- Blogue Ian Bicking
Le moteur de recherche de Le PHP Facile fait peau neuve.

En effet, maintenant, il donne des vrais résultats, et surtout il recherche dans toutes les principales rubriques du site :
- les news
- les cours
- les comment faire
- les forums

Les résultats sont ordonnées en fonction de la pertinence des résultats.

Ce moteur de recherche utilise les index FULLTEXT de MySQL ainsi que la recherche booléenne de MySQL.

- index FULLTEXT recherche booléenne en MySQL
- le moteur de recherche
LoadingChargement en cours